What is recorded here
Within an enclosure (MA093-015002-).
The remains consist of a low, roughly rectangular rise (13m NNW–SSE; c. 8-10m ENE–WSW; H 0.4m) with an uneven, hummocky surface. It is scattered with low, sod-covered stones, probably gravemarkers. A sandpit, now disused, lies immediately to N.
